Precision Pulse Acquisition for Flowmeters and Rotary Encoders
The Honeywell 51404351-175 TK-MDP081 pulse input module offers eight independent channels for frequency measurement. This module accurately counts pulses from turbines, flowmeters, and encoders. It also measures frequency and totalizes events from field devices. You can rely on this module for precise rate calculations in critical applications. Its robust design ensures reliable operation in noisy industrial environments.
Input Characteristics and Signal Processing
Each channel accepts a wide range of input signal types. The module supports dry contact, voltage, and current inputs. It also includes programmable debounce filtering for switch contacts. This filtering eliminates false counts from contact bounce. The module features a high maximum input frequency for fast pulse trains. It also provides a low-frequency mode for slow-speed sensors.
Key Technical Specifications
| Parameter | Specification |
|---|---|
| Manufacturer | Honeywell Process Solutions |
| Model | 51404351-175 TK-MDP081 |
| Product Type | Pulse Input Module |
| Number of Channels | 8 (Isolated) |
| Input Types | Dry Contact, Voltage (5-30 VDC), Current (4-20 mA) |
| Maximum Frequency | 10 kHz (High-Speed Mode) |
| Minimum Frequency | 0.01 Hz (Low-Speed Mode) |
| Pulse Width Requirement | > 50 µs (High Speed); > 50 ms (Low Speed) |
| Input Impedance | 3.3 kΩ (Voltage Mode); 250 Ω (Current Mode) |
| Debounce Filter | 0 to 100 ms (Programmable) |
| Count Range | 32-bit (0 to 4,294,967,295) |
| Accuracy | ±0.01% of Reading |
| Isolation Voltage | 1500 VAC (Channel to Backplane) |
| Power Consumption | 5 VDC: < 200 mA; 24 VDC: < 100 mA |
| LED Indicators | Channel Active, Pulse Present |
| Dimensions | 28.5 cm x 17.8 cm x 5.5 cm (H x W x D) |
| Weight | Approximately 0.8 kg |
| Termination Assembly | Requires separate TA for field wiring |
| Operating Temperature | 0°C to 60°C |
| Storage Temperature | -40°C to 85°C |
| Relative Humidity | 5% to 95% (Non-condensing) |
Frequency Measurement and Totalization Capabilities
The module simultaneously measures frequency on all eight channels. It also accumulates total pulse counts for each input independently. The module stores these totals in non-volatile memory for data retention. This memory preserves count values during power loss events. The module also supports programmable scaling for engineering units. You can directly read flow rates in liters per minute.
Signal Conditioning and Noise Immunity
The module employs opto-isolation to protect the backplane from field transients. This isolation prevents ground loops and common-mode noise interference. The module also includes a built-in signal conditioner for each channel. This conditioner converts raw pulses into clean logic signals. Furthermore, its high noise immunity ensures accurate counting in electrically noisy areas.
Physical Dimensions and Interface Connections
This module measures 28.5 cm in height and 17.8 cm in width. Its depth is 5.5 cm for standard rack installation. The device weighs approximately 0.8 kilograms. It interfaces with field devices via a separate Termination Assembly. This assembly provides convenient screw terminals for each channel. The front panel houses eight LED status indicators. These LEDs show pulse activity for each input channel.
Installation, Configuration, and Application Notes
You can install the 51404351-175 TK-MDP081 into any TDC 3000 rack slot. Configuration involves setting jumpers for input type selection. Software then defines the frequency range and scaling parameters. This module suits flow totalization in custody transfer applications. It also provides speed monitoring for rotating machinery. Additionally, the module serves position feedback from linear encoders.
